West Virginia’s game this week represents more than just trying to repair a season, it’s also the annual “Coal Rush” game.

And even though WVU fans have already been aware of the uniform combination for weeks, the program still shared a video to promote the alternate look ahead of the game.

Both DraftKings and FanDuel are predicting the Horned Frogs to dominate the Mountaineers. And if WVU doesn’t find some way to show signs of life, that’s exactly what’s going to happen.

At 2-5 overall and 0-4 in the Big 12, there’s not much for even the most optimistic WVU fan to point to as a sign of better days to come. The hope has to be in Rodriguez and the belief he will fulfill his promise to make West Virginia great again, granted that may take more time than initially advertised.

Conversely, TCU still has plenty left to play for. The Horned Frogs enter Week 9 at 5-2, granted they’re only 2-2 within the Big 12. TCU is looking to build a win steak after pulling out a win in a shootout against Baylor.

The Mountaineers debuted their “Coal Rush” uniform last season against Iowa State.
